Zydus Wellness Products Limited v. M/S Arihant Remedies & Anr.

CS(COMM) 417/2019

The Delhi High Court confirmed the existing ad-interim injunction in favor of Zydus Wellness Products Limited against M/S Arihant Remedies & Anr. The court found that the defendant's product was prima facie deceptively similar to the plaintiff's registered trademark and trade dress, despite arguments regarding ownership transfer and territorial jurisdiction. This ruling reinforces the protection afforded to established brands through both trademark law and passing off principles.

patentCS(COMM) 469/2023

Grip Invest Technologies Private LimitedvsAshok Kumar & Ors.

The Delhi High Court granted an interim injunction in favor of Grip Invest Technologies, restraining a newly discovered mirroring website (eliteedgebrokerage.info) from operating. The court found that the new site was an exact copy of the plaintiff's website, infringing both copyright and trademark. Furthermore, the court directed the Domain Name Registrar and the Department of Telecommunication to take immediate steps to block access to the infringing domain, reinforcing proactive measures against online IP infringement.

patentFAO(OS)(COMM) Nos. 22&23/2023

Shamrock Geoscience Ltd & Anr.vsTimab NL B.V. / Kaba Infratech Pvt Ltd

In a significant settlement, the Delhi High Court accepted assurances from Shamrock Geoscience Ltd. that they would cease using the disputed mark 'GeoCrete,' replacing it with 'Alpave.' The company agreed to withdraw its existing trademark registration (TM No.3392787) and all related pending applications within four weeks. This resolution effectively settled the core trademark dispute between Shamrock Geoscience and Timab NL B.V./Kaba Infratech, allowing both parties to move forward while leaving technical know-how claims open for separate litigation.

patentCS (OS) 985/2012

M/S Parimal MandirvsBharat Vasi Sugandhit Dhoop & Ors

The Delhi High Court ruled in favor of M/S Parimal Mandir, a leading manufacturer of incense sticks, finding that the defendants were engaging in passing off and intellectual property infringement. The court found that the defendants' use of deceptively similar trade dress, packaging, and branding for their Dhoop products created an overall visual impression likely to mislead consumers into believing the goods originated from the plaintiff. Consequently, a decree was passed granting permanent injunctions against the defendants and ordering the destruction of infringing materials.

patentC.O.(COMM.IPD-CR) 761/2022

Sweeton Foods Pvt LtdvsM/S Grv Conferectionery And Foods

Sweeton Foods Pvt Ltd filed a petition seeking the cancellation of a copyright held by M/S Grv Conferectionery And Foods for the label 'KARTIER GOLD 24 CARAT SWISS MILK CHOCO'. This action stemmed from an earlier civil suit regarding trademark infringement. The court found that since the respondent had undertaken in a settlement decree to withdraw and cancel the registration, the petition was allowed.
